sold from September 1971 through 1975. A standard, factory produced H2 was able to travel a quarter mile from a standing start in 12.0 seconds. It handled better than the Mach III that preceded it. By the standards of its time, its handling was sufficient to make it the production bike to beat on the race track. Nonetheless, its tendency to pull wheelies and a less than solid feel through high speed corners led to adjustments to the design as it evolved. More than any other model, it created Kawasaki's reputation for building what motorcycle journalist Alastair Walker called, "scarily fast, good-looking, no holds barred motorcycles", and led to a further decline in the market place of the British motorcycle industry.

In 1973, there were minor mechanical changes made to the carburetor jets, oil injection pump and cylinder port timing in an effort by the factory to get more MPG from the H2A. Because of these changes the most powerful H2 was the 1972 model. In 1974 the H2B engine was modified for more civilized performance at the expense of raw power. The race tail was slimmed down from the previous year. An oil-based steering damper and check valve were added. The power was reduced to at 6,800 rpm. The oil injection system was substantially changed with two separate sets of injection lines, unlike the earlier models with one set of lines. Oil was injected into the carburetors on a separate line. The oil injection to the bottom end bearings (both main and rod big ends) was retained as a single branched line. A longer swingarm improved stability. The final model had a weight of .
